Latest Patents
Rios holds a patent for a Weld Test Tool. This invention features a pair of semicircular jaws that seal against the outer periphery of a pipe adjacent to a butt weld joint. The jaws are designed with annular pressure rims that apply mechanical pressure against the outer surface of the pipe. This mechanism creates an annular manifold cavity between the pressure rims, allowing high gas pressure to be applied against the joint and adjacent areas of the pipe. The purpose of this design is to slightly deform the pipe and open up any fissures that may exist due to an imperfect joint. In a modified version, a cylindrical shroud carries an annulus of balls that support and apply deforming pressure on the side portions of the pipe as the shroud rotates around it.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Rios has worked with prominent companies such as Fluoroware, Inc. and Texas Instruments Corporation. His experience in these organizations has contributed to his development as an inventor and has provided him with valuable insights into the engineering field.
